VISION FOR RECONCILIATION

The St. Edward's College community’s vision for reconciliation aligns with the EREA Touchstones. We strive for a united and respectful understanding of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ander peoples, rights, cultures, and histories. 

At its heart, our vision for reconciliation is to further develop the teaching and understanding of Australia's true histories and to ensure an educationally authentic and inclusive College, which strengthens its relationships with all community members including members of the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ander communities. 

We embrace walking alongside all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ander peoples, with an open mind and heart to establish respect and kindness for the Custodians of the oldest living cultures in the world and aim to nurture a school culture that promotes equality, equity and justice for all people.
